TAB 8 TAB 7 TAB 6 TAB 5 REFERENCE Details on discs to store Some additional details may help you use this Bose® home entertainment system to its fullest. More about compatible discs Other than MP3 you cannot import data disc audio formats such as Windows Media Audio (WMA) and those protected by Digital Rights Management (DRM). For details on creating MP3 files, refer to the music management system on your computer. Other details: • You can store the same song from both an MP3 disc and an audio CD. However, music data that is provided with the MP3 does not apply to this same song from the audio CD. • If the songs from one album are stored, some from an MP3 disc and others from an audio CD, they will not all be recognized as coming from the same album. • For any MP3 files to be recognized as songs from the same album, they must be stored from the same MP3 disc. A two-session disc qualifies as one disc. Before copying audio material onto your computer or creating an MP3 CD, you should: •Make sure you have the legal right to copy the particular audio content; •Avoid sources of audio material that may be questionable, such as certain file sharing facilities; •Not use the copies or CDs as a means to share audio content with others, but confine such copying, where permissible, to your personal use. 26 TAB 4 TAB 3 TAB 2 English • The same track from two different MP3 discs will be stored only once. When you press the CD # for the disc stored first, the track will play. It will not play, however, when you press CD # for the disc stored later. • If an album is on an MP3 disc twice, after storing, it shows up just once under Albums. If there are two different artists associated with the album, however, each track appears twice in the Album list. • If an audio CD and an MP3 disc contain the same album, this album will be stored twice and listed twice in the Albums category of the Music Library. The tracks will be listed once under each album, but twice in the list of all Tracks.
